The Earth's atmosphere is a complex system that plays a crucial role in regulating the planet's climate and weather patterns. One of the key components of this system is atmospheric vapour(大气水汽). This term refers to the water vapor present in the air, which is an essential part of the hydrological cycle. Water vapor is not only a significant greenhouse gas but also contributes to the formation of clouds and precipitation. Understanding atmospheric vapour(大气水汽)is vital for comprehending how weather systems function and how climate change impacts our environment.When the sun heats the Earth's surface, water from oceans, rivers, and lakes evaporates into the atmosphere, transforming into atmospheric vapour(大气水汽). This process is influenced by various factors such as temperature, humidity, and wind patterns. As the water vapor rises, it cools and condenses into tiny droplets, forming clouds. These clouds can hold significant amounts of moisture, and when they become heavy enough, they release this moisture as precipitation, which includes rain, snow, or sleet.The presence of atmospheric vapour(大气水汽)also plays a critical role in the greenhouse effect. Water vapor is one of the most abundant greenhouse gases in the atmosphere, trapping heat and keeping the Earth warm. This natural process is essential for life as we know it; without it, our planet would be too cold to support life. However, human activities, such as burning fossil fuels and deforestation, have increased the concentration of greenhouse gases, including atmospheric vapour(大气水汽). This enhancement of the greenhouse effect leads to global warming and climate change, which pose significant challenges to ecosystems and human societies.In addition to its role in climate regulation, atmospheric vapour(大气水汽)is also crucial for the distribution of fresh water. Many regions rely on precipitation generated from water vapor for their water supply. Changes in atmospheric vapour(大气水汽)levels can lead to alterations in rainfall patterns, resulting in droughts or floods. For instance, areas that typically experience regular rainfall may find themselves facing severe water shortages due to changes in atmospheric vapour(大气水汽)concentration. Conversely, regions that are usually dry may experience increased rainfall, leading to flooding and erosion.Moreover, atmospheric vapour(大气水汽)affects not just the quantity of precipitation but also its quality. Pollutants and particles in the atmosphere can interact with water vapor, leading to acid rain, which can harm ecosystems and reduce biodiversity. Therefore, monitoring and understanding atmospheric vapour(大气水汽)is essential for environmental protection and sustainable management of water resources.In conclusion, atmospheric vapour(大气水汽)is a fundamental component of our planet's atmosphere, influencing weather, climate, and water resources. Its significance cannot be overstated, as it affects both natural ecosystems and human activities. As we face the challenges of climate change, understanding the dynamics of atmospheric vapour(大气水汽)will be crucial for developing effective strategies to mitigate its impacts and adapt to a changing world.
